" Doberman Security and Automation has, as the name suggests, two major parts of functionality. The first part is security. Using a supported home automation computer interface such as the X10 CM11a computer interface and motion sensors supported by the interface, such as X10 passive IR motion detectors (Hawkeye, etc.,) Doberman can help deter intruders and warn you of possible breakin by sounding alarms and sending email messages to up to four addresses (work, pager, celularphone, etc.). Doberman supports four alarms types, from security and fire to flood and temperature. Connect a security camera for added security. The second peice of major functionality is Home Automation. Doberman can monitor lamps, heating / cooling and other devices being turned on and off and, using the visual macro builder (Action Spider) and the Lighting Effect Wizard. Doberman also acts as a server for an HTML automation interface as well as serving to smart clients such as touchscreen TabletPC, PocketPC, Smartphones, etc. "
